Global Antiviral Drugs Market Report to 2030 - Rising Public Awareness Regarding Usage of Antiviral Therapeutics is Driving Growth - ResearchAndMarkets.com

DUBLIN--(BUSINESS WIRE)--The "Antiviral Drugs Market, By Drug Type, By Application, By Mechanism of Action, By Distribution Channel, and By Region Forecast to 2030" report has been added to ResearchAndMarkets.com's offering.

The global antiviral drugs market size is expected to reach USD 50.02 Billion in 2030 and register a revenue CAGR of 3.4% during the forecast period, according to latest report.

The antiviral drugs market is growing on account of the continued prevalence of viral diseases and infections globally.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), it is estimated that every year, 16% of the world population suffers from one or more viral diseases.

However, the high cost of antiviral drugs is expected to hamper market growth in the near future. According to a report by the World Health Organization (WHO), the cost of one year's treatment for hepatitis C can range from USD 300 to USD 1,000 in low- and middle-income countries. Moreover, the cost of new antiviral drugs for treating hepatitis C can be as high as USD 100,000 per patient in some cases. Such high costs are expected to limit market growth in the coming years.

Some Key Highlights in the Report

  • By disease type, the market is bifurcated into hepatitis B, influenza, hepatitis C, human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), and others. The hepatitis B segment is projected to register the highest CAGR of 4.8% during the forecast period.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), in 2015, an estimated 257 million people were living with chronic hepatitis B worldwide. Moreover, according to WHO data, in 2016, an estimated 887,000 people died from hepatitis B, making it one of the leading causes of death globally.
  • On the basis of drug type, the market is divided into n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itors (NRTIs), non-n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itors (NNRTIs), protease inhibitors (PIs), entry inhibitors, and others. The NRTIs segment is expected to register the highest CAGR of 4.6% during the forecast period. NRTIs are a class of drugs that work by inhibiting reverse transcriptase, an enzyme responsible for replication of retroviruses such as HIV-1.
  • By treatment type, the market is classified into combination therapy and single therapy. The combination therapy segment is expected to register the highest CAGR of 4.4% during the forecast period. The segment is growing on account of the efficacy of combination therapy in treating viral infections. According to a study published in the journal AIDS, combination therapy is more effective than single-drug therapy in treating HIV infection.
  • By route of administration, the market is categorized into oral and parenteral. The oral segment is expected to register the highest CAGR of 4.2% during the forecast period. The segment is growing on account of the convenience and ease of administration associated with oral drugs.
  • By region, the market is classified into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, Latin America, and the Middle East & Africa. North America is expected to hold the largest market share of 37.1% by 2023. The region is anticipated to witness significant growth on account of the high prevalence of viral diseases and the availability of advanced healthcare facilities in the region.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), in 2015, an estimated 3.2 million people in the U.S. were living with chronic hepatitis C.
